Session Description:
During orogenesis, deep crustal rocks commonly reach pressure–temperature conditions sufficient for partial melting to occur, either during burial or exhumation. The presence of melt has major rheologic implications for mountain building, as it changes the viscosity, density, and how strain is partitioned during orogenesis. In addition, melt extraction and magma emplacement contribute to crustal differentiation and stabilization over geologic time. These combined processes may also drive the collapse and exhumation of orogenic belts, and aid in exhuming (ultra)high-pressure terranes. This session seeks contributions that investigate the quantity, timing, and/or conditions at which partial melting occurs in different geodynamic environments, and the implications that anatexis has on the evolution of orogenic belts and subducted crustal material. We encourage abstracts that use a variety of techniques, such as field mapping, phase equilibria modeling, petrochronology, geochemistry, and geodynamic and/or geophysical modeling.
